The McCormick-Deering T-40 was a gasoline engined crawler tractor built by the International Harvester company from 1937 to 1939 in Chicago, Illinois, USA.
Model history[]
- For Company history, see International Harvester.
The McCormick-Deering T-40 was an update of the TA-40, with more power from a larger 298 ci 6-cylinder engine running at a higher 1750 rpm. It competed with the Allis-Chalmers K, Caterpillar Forty, and Cletrac CG.
Timeline[]
- 1932 - McCormick-Deering TA-40 crawler introduced
- 1937 - TA-40 upgraded to become the T-40
- 1939 - T-40 replaced by International T-14

Serial Numbers Information[]
Year | Serial no. run start[1] |
Serial no. run End[1] |
Number Built[2] | Notes |
---|---|---|---|---|
1937 | 6303 | 7718 | 1416 | Serial range and yearly total include T-40 and TD-40 |
1938 | 7719 | 8598 | 880 | |
1939 | 8599 | 9565 | 967 | |
Total built | 1666[1] | T-40 only |
